Directorate of Fisheries selling fish in Guwahati

Pratidin Bureau

The Directorate of Fisheries has set up stalls for Uruka today. These stalls selling fish have been opened from 7 AM.

The stalls have been set up at Chandmari, Noonmati, Wireless, Rupnagar and Maligaon among few others. The prices at these stalls is reported to be less than the market prices.

According to official reports, these stalls expect to sell around 1,500 kg of fresh traditional varieties of fish such as Rou, Bhokua and Chital.

The fist stock is reportedly brought from cooperative societies, giving them a platform to sell their harvest.
